March is Colorectal Cancer Awareness Month—a good reminder to take care of your future self. For many adults at average risk, the USPSTF recommends starting screening at age 45 (earlier if you have certain risk factors). St. Luke offers colonoscopy and endoscopy procedures as part of our surgical services—talk with your primary care provider about what’s right for you.

St. Luke is offering the 2026 Rosemary Miller Memorial College Scholarship to local deserving students. These $500 scholarships are paid in two equal payments of $250 for the first and second semester registration and are named in honor of long-time employee and former St. Luke Director of Nursing, Rosemary Miller.

The basic criteria is a high school cumulative GPA of 3.0 or better. Other factors that are typically considered include: activities, honors, awards, community service activities, and the applicant’s educational goals. Information packets are available from local school counselors, at the hospital front desk, or online at https://stlukehealthcare.org/.

** In honor of National Heart Month, St. Luke is offering a Cardiac Risk Assessment package throughout the month of February! **

For just $49, you'll receive a complete metabolic panel, lipid panel, hemoglobin A1C test, and blood pressure screening. You and your doctor can then review the results together to determine what, if any, next steps are needed to help protect or improve your heart health.

No appointment necessary - simply come to St. Luke Community Hospital in Ronan (M-F 7:30 am - 5 pm), 12 hours fasted (that means water and meds only for 12 hours prior to your tests), and check in at the front desk. Please let staff know you're here for the heart health month package and they will take payment at the time of service. No health insurance is billed for this package.
